Daniel%20GalmicheFrench chef Daniel Galmiche’s Eden, the fine dining restaurant at the Forbury Hotel in Reading opens its doors to diners today.

The restaurant within the five star 23-bedroom hotel is limited to 20 covers and will run alongside its brasserie-style restaurant, Cerise.

Galmiche, who joined the hotel from the Clermont Club where he was Executive Head Chef, said: “The fine dining experience at Eden celebrating the best of British produce coupled with the relaxed brasserie-style of the existing Cerise restaurant and bar and of course the designer sexiness of the hotel itself creates a place to see and be seen.”

The French chef is aiming for Michelin star status at the restaurant, set in a former council chamber. He previously gained Michelin stars at Waldo’s at Cliveden in Berkshire, Harvey’s in Briston and l’Ortolan near Reading.

The Forbury Hotel and 16 apartments in Reading opened in 2006 following a £15m redevelopment.
